Here is the equation that was given to us:

Solomona has 81 tennis balls
There are 3 tennis balls in each can 
How many cans should there be?

My groups answer to this equation was that there should be 27 cans.
Because 81 ➗ 3 = 27, how do you know that? Well we knew that 20x3=60 and 7x3=21 and so we added the to answers altogether and our answer was 81.
